How Reliable is the Kia Carens?

Based on 476,991 MOT tests across 36,863 vehicles.

70.3%
Pass Rate
6,950
Miles/Year
26
Year Lifespan
36,863
On UK Roads

Top MOT Failure Points

Parking brake: efficiency below requirements 29,613
T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m 18,176
parking brake recording little or no effort 12,318
position lamp(s) not working 11,979
Windscreen wiper does not clear the windscreen effectively 10,018

LC56 EOX is a 2006 Kia Carens in Black with a 1,991c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 16 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 62.5%.

Across all 2006 Kia Carens models, the average MOT pass rate is 66.5% with a typical mileage of 62,920 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Kia Carens f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 29,613 recorded failures. If you're considering buying LC56 EOX,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Kia Carens typically stays on UK roads for around 26 years. At 20 years old, this Kia Carens is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
